Overview of Subscription-Based Versions



Subscription-based medical care versions, occasionally referred to as direct health care or concierge medication, are increasingly gaining attention as a prospective remedy to ineffectiveness within standard healthcare systems. These versions run on the principle of offering clients straight access to healthcare service providers with a yearly or regular monthly cost, bypassing the need for conventional insurance devices. This arrangement intends to simplify patient-provider communications by minimizing administrative worries, which commonly hinder customized and timely care.


At the core of subscription-based models is the focus on a much more personalized person experience. Patients gain from enhanced access to their doctors, usually including next-day or same-day consultations, expanded appointment times, and direct communication networks such as phone or video clip calls. This version cultivates a positive method to health care, where carriers and clients can collaboratively concentrate on preventative treatment and chronic illness administration.

In addition, medical professionals functioning under these designs typically experience reduced patient tons, allowing them to dedicate more time and focus per individual. This can result in improved patient satisfaction and outcomes, as carriers can concentrate on providing top quality care as opposed to navigating complicated insurance protocols. Subscription-based healthcare, as a result, stands for a promising evolution in the delivery of customized and effective treatment.

While the customized care aspect of direct key care models is appealing, recognizing their financial effects contrasted to typical insurance coverage is important. Subscription-based healthcare models often involve a fixed month-to-month fee, covering a wide range of solutions such as assessments, regular check-ups, and certain analysis tests. This framework contrasts with conventional insurance, where co-pays, costs, and deductibles can vary, possibly leading to unforeseen expenditures.


One of the key monetary advantages of membership versions is openness in prices. On the other hand, conventional insurance coverage might be extra useful for people needing specialized care or pricey therapies not covered under a registration version, as they profit from the wider insurance coverage network and cost-sharing devices.




Nonetheless, cost-effectiveness is context-dependent. While registration models might offer financial savings for those mostly requiring medical care, individuals with chronic conditions or specialized medical care requirements could locate typical insurance policy a lot more detailed. As a result, evaluating details health care requirements and possible use is crucial in figuring out one of the most cost-effective choice for people.




Effect on Client Contentment



Patient complete satisfaction within subscription-based medical care versions usually mirrors a significant renovation over typical insurance policy systems. This improvement is largely associated to the customized care and access these versions offer. Patients regularly report higher satisfaction due to lowered wait times and the ease of organizing consultations. Unlike conventional systems, where patients could experience hold-ups in receiving treatment, subscription-based versions make certain more prompt and direct interactions with medical care carriers.


Additionally, the openness in expenses associated with subscription-based medical care minimizes the common frustrations connected to unanticipated charges and complicated billing processes seen in typical insurance (subscription based healthcare). Clients appreciate understanding the precise financial commitment upfront, causing boosted trust and confidence in their health care monitoring


Additionally, the emphasis on preventive treatment and wellness in subscription versions adds to enhanced health and wellness results, additionally improving client complete satisfaction. By concentrating on continuous wellness maintenance as opposed to anecdotal treatment, clients experience a more continuous and all natural medical care trip.


Moreover, the improved provider-patient relationship cultivated in these models, identified by even more time spent per person and personalized focus, plays a crucial duty in raising client satisfaction degrees, as individuals feel truly cared for and recognized.
